From d8072ede61453c6a22ab5b8a86ce85802357e408 Mon Sep 17 00:00:00 2001 From: Gargantuanman Date: Fri, 1 Jan 2016 01:20:12 -0600 Subject: [PATCH 1/2] Update MFRC522.h For NTAG 213,215,126 Authentification --- MFRC522.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/MFRC522.h b/MFRC522.h index 36102e7..110603b 100644 --- a/MFRC522.h +++ b/MFRC522.h @@ -372,6 +372,8 @@ public: MFRC522::StatusCode MIFARE_Transfer(byte blockAddr); MFRC522::StatusCode MIFARE_GetValue(byte blockAddr, long *value); MFRC522::StatusCode MIFARE_SetValue(byte blockAddr, long value); + MFRC522::StatusCode PCD_NTAG216_AUTH(byte *passWord); + ///////////////////////////////////////////////////////////////////////////////////// // Support functions From 143f46f729d6b5c39ca0d75b2e23dcce9cf7666e Mon Sep 17 00:00:00 2001 From: Gargantuanman Date: Fri, 1 Jan 2016 01:38:44 -0600 Subject: [PATCH 2/2] Update MFRC522.h now returns the passACK --- MFRC522.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/MFRC522.h b/MFRC522.h index 110603b..72f8411 100644 --- a/MFRC522.h +++ b/MFRC522.h @@ -372,7 +372,7 @@ public: MFRC522::StatusCode MIFARE_Transfer(byte blockAddr); MFRC522::StatusCode MIFARE_GetValue(byte blockAddr, long *value); MFRC522::StatusCode MIFARE_SetValue(byte blockAddr, long value); - MFRC522::StatusCode PCD_NTAG216_AUTH(byte *passWord); + MFRC522::StatusCode PCD_NTAG216_AUTH(byte *passWord, byte pACK[]); /////////////////////////////////////////////////////////////////////////////////////